Output 628d23ede5df9651f851c685a55b1269ad824515149c1edd35865f07ca1184a1:27

value
1062127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e195c1943c07d6674c36995f32d9f2728938b76f OP_EQUAL
address
3NFoMwrXz3nXT9EwLz49b16Z1Q8b7qXBix
transaction
628d23ede5df9651f851c685a55b1269ad824515149c1edd35865f07ca1184a1
confirmations
278457
spent
true